Output 81d86ba7c70b97ed9034ed7a4c6401597be9cf69a566f4c24addd046fc9733b4:8

value
12397892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e859754265e5a402935c8eefde11ee87996a676 OP_EQUAL
address
MF4LyU44ctwHBJzEvX7z4uVm3CchjYtW4G
transaction
81d86ba7c70b97ed9034ed7a4c6401597be9cf69a566f4c24addd046fc9733b4
spent
true